Growth Dynamics: Drivers and Challenges Macroeconomic Factors Healthcare Expenditure Growth: South Korea’s healthcare spending has grown at a CAGR of 6.5% over the past five years, supporting increased investment in rare disease diagnostics and therapeutics. Demographic Shifts: The aging population (over 65 years) now accounts for approximately 16% of the total population, elevating the prevalence of genetic and chronic lung diseases, including A1LD. Government Policies: National health strategies prioritize rare disease management, with funding allocations for diagnostic infrastructure and research. Industry-Specific Drivers Diagnostic Advancements: Development of sensitive assays for Alpha-1 Antitrypsin deficiency (AATD), the primary cause of A1LD, has improved detection rates. Therapeutic Innovations: Introduction of novel augmentation therapies and gene editing approaches are expanding treatment options. Patient Advocacy and Awareness: Increased patient advocacy groups and awareness campaigns are fueling demand for early diagnosis and personalized treatment. Market Ecosystem and Operational Framework Key Product Categories Diagnostic Tests: Including serum AAT level assays, genetic testing kits, and imaging modalities. Therapeutic Agents: Augmentation therapies (e.g., Prolastin, Zemaira), emerging gene therapies, and small molecule drugs. Monitoring Devices: Portable spirometers, wearable sensors, and digital health platforms. Stakeholders Manufacturers: Global and regional pharmaceutical and biotech firms developing diagnostics and therapies. Healthcare Providers: Hospitals, specialized clinics, and pulmonology centers. Regulatory Bodies: Ministry of Food and Drug Safety (MFDS), Korean Disease Control and Prevention Agency (KDCA). Patients and Advocacy Groups: Driving awareness, funding, and policy support. Distributors and Service Providers: Ensuring supply chain efficiency and after-sales support.
